AdaptHealth Investigates Cybersecurity Incident on Patient Data

July 9, 2026 1 Min Read 0

Threat Intelligence Brief

Threat Risk: High

Victim: AdaptHealth

Incident: Data breach resulting from unauthorized access to cloud-based business applications.

Impact: Exfiltration of patient personally identifiable information (PII), protected health information (PHI), and insurance billing passwords.

Attacker: Unidentified threat actors
